    Now that Assault on Balaurea has rolled around, the most-asked questions in Aion's LFG chat revolve not around the new zones, the new solo instances, or even the new event quest (which hasn't been started yet, by the way) -- but around pets! At times, the spam gets on the nerves of Daeva who watch the same questions pour in over and over and over again as new players log in throughout the first days. To help answer these questions, NCsoft has updated its PowerWiki with a very informative article on the pet system to complement the pet FAQ. With just a click, you get the who, where, and what of starting your adventure in Aion pet ownership. Taking the guesswork out of adopting your newest companion, this article is broken up into easy-to-access sections answering the major questions, complete with step-by-step instructions. Pets are categorized depending on function, and each pet has a labeled picture to show you exactly how it looks. Even those who think they know enough about pets can find gems of important information within this article; one very significant item to note is that, contrary to popular belief, signal pets will not alert you if the attacker is in hide mode. Another hidden gem is that pets are now available as daily quest rewards.     New (or newly returned) to Aion and curious about the recently added daily quests? Well you're not alone, as your humble correspondent has been playing for awhile now and was having trouble unearthing any definitive information regarding the system just added in the 1.9 patch. Happily, NCsoft has updated its PowerWiki with a lengthy entry devoted to answering all of your daily quest needs. Everything from where to get to them, to what kind of rewards they offer, to how to join the requisite NPC factions, is available in the new article. "Every morning at 9 o'clock, the organization will send a new Quest notice that can be found at the bottom of your screen. Once you click on the icon, you can choose to either accept or decline the Daily Quest. If you accidentally decline the Quest, you can quit and then re-join the organization to get it again," the article says. Check out all the details over at the official Aion PowerWiki.
